Fusion5 recently announced that they are the official sponsors of the inaugural Live Chat Award category of the prestigious 2016 CRM Contact Centre Awards, the largest awards for the Contact Centre industry in New Zealand, with the winners being announced on 16 September at a high-profile ceremony in Auckland.

We have all become aware of the many benefits of Live Chat, which is becoming more and more prevalent when we go shopping online. It is so much more convenient to be able to quickly reach an agent without having to leave the website, or navigate a time consuming IVR on the phone.

Live chat is consistently a favourite engagement type among customers and/or businesses, and Oracle Service Cloud Live Chat enables our customer service agents to interact with customers and proactively guide them to the best outcomes, as well as fast track the sales process by answering questions while they browse products and services ‘live’.

Live Chat can reduce call centre costs to serve by up to 80%, increasing agent productivity and first contact resolution.  It also helps to significantly reduce shopping cart abandonment and increases website sales conversion rates, while improving customer satisfaction significantly, and with the offer of immediate assistance when it’s required.

Live Chat is extremely beneficial to both the customer and the call centre, increasing sales conversion rates and the average order size for the seller, while, at the same time, reducing shopping cart abandonment. Live Chat can increase customer retention and loyalty with its personalised interactions, reducing call centre costs and increasing efficiency. It can also achieve highest customer satisfaction compared to other channels.
